Global Amebocyte Lysate Market Overview And Scope:
Global Amebocyte Lysate Market Size was estimated at USD 457.66 million in 2022 and is projected to reach USD 737.71 million by 2028, exhibiting a CAGR of 8.28% during the forecast period.
